gfx/thebes/gfxPlatform.cpp
c71022b03df808e4c176f269ec727a3338767dfe
created 2018-01-23 16:17 -0600
pushed 2018-03-01 16:46 +0000
Ryan Hunt Ryan Hunt - Add paint worker count to crash report notes. (bug 1432516, r=milan)
e61c4485494ec4823da22217f665d73858c57e35
created 2018-01-11 11:54 +0200
pushed 2018-01-11 21:05 +0000
Ciure Andrei Ciure Andrei - Merge inbound to mozilla-central r=merge a=merge
b7d96ef3b33c77e7a8fe367d4b6c463a07aac63a
created 2017-12-08 01:18 -0600
pushed 2018-01-11 21:05 +0000
Ryan Hunt Ryan Hunt - Create a PaintWorker thread pool and dispatch tiles to it (bug 1425056, r=bas)
89d7853edd6412328c70ffec3f451da3aa9b1f34
created 2018-01-10 13:09 -0500
pushed 2018-01-11 21:05 +0000
Milan Sreckovic Milan Sreckovic - Bug 1425260: gfx.webrender.all turns on all preferences that are needed for webrender. r=kats
3ac75a8a4e8cc3fe6ab57872106c8749d2c4eac1
created 2017-12-21 09:25 -0500
pushed 2018-01-11 21:05 +0000
Kartikaya Gupta Kartikaya Gupta - Bug 1426191 - Update test_acceleration to check for webrender windows. r=dvander
1a51f96077609295f10a6b6715eae7738a47ee8a
created 2017-12-18 17:06 -0800
pushed 2018-01-11 21:05 +0000
sotaro sotaro - Bug 1425791 - Update WebRenderDebugPref r=jrmuizel
ced781e57166b6d1169bde63f8c57dbb924e75b8
created 2017-12-08 14:58 -0600
pushed 2018-01-11 21:05 +0000
Ryan Hunt Ryan Hunt - Disable OMTP only if edge padding is enabled and tiling is also enabled (bug 1424325, r=bas)
6a8d5147a4164fcf67107403fe01f7050206bd2a
created 2017-11-21 19:12 -0500
pushed 2018-01-11 21:05 +0000
Ryan Hunt Ryan Hunt - Implement record and replay painting for multi tiled layers (bug 1422392, r=nical)
d03fbd96113d132f578d6088efeab011343ae48c
created 2017-12-04 08:56 -0600
pushed 2018-01-11 21:05 +0000
James Willcox James Willcox - Bug 1421313 - Remove TexturePoolOGL r=jgilbert
06f2b3ee174ee56ef7e65d12e00dcfe4fd1e39b8
created 2017-12-06 09:52 -0600
pushed 2018-01-11 21:05 +0000
James Willcox James Willcox - Back out bug 1421313 because of build breakage on a CLOSED TREE r=me
b9123a220811b16cdb0b54cbc254d01792c879ad
created 2017-12-04 08:56 -0600
pushed 2018-01-11 21:05 +0000
James Willcox James Willcox - Bug 1421313 - Remove TexturePoolOGL r=nical
3ccf02d862c888c1a7fb0d3420571e61ff9aba05
created 2017-08-11 13:41 -0700
pushed 2018-01-11 21:05 +0000
Jeff Gilbert Jeff Gilbert - Bug 1390386 - Remove old TLS current-context check. - r=daoshengmu
7e60ad275b73df53b06eebe2d71b788016e45cd6
created 2017-11-24 20:58 +0900
pushed 2018-01-11 21:05 +0000
sotaro sotaro - Bug 1391159 - Handle WebRender ProgramBinary usage r=nical
7d871d84a6a2949233711317587c8ba19965555b
created 2017-10-10 15:11 +0200
pushed 2018-01-11 21:05 +0000
Gabriele Svelto Gabriele Svelto - Bug 1402519 - Remove MOZ_CRASHREPORTER directives from gfx; r=jrmuizel
3ba9de562f5a39f05c4f9a6bb11a0483422ed421
created 2017-11-23 16:01 +0100
pushed 2018-01-11 21:05 +0000
Nicolas Silva Nicolas Silva - Bug 1420123 - Expose more WebRender debug flags to prefs. r=kvark
ffc12802d5585e08de1a9ae4f2939e05bbea5767
created 2017-11-23 00:11 +0200
pushed 2018-01-11 21:05 +0000
shindli shindli - Backed out 16 changesets (bug 1402519) for conflicts during merge r=backout on a CLOSED TREE
e801b0c001346e17c845849f4769827c25bd49ec
created 2017-10-10 15:11 +0200
pushed 2018-01-11 21:05 +0000
Gabriele Svelto Gabriele Svelto - Bug 1402519 - Remove MOZ_CRASHREPORTER directives from gfx; r=jrmuizel
df10cef47ecc86603ac88a87045bce6b78a5af76
created 2017-11-14 19:06 +1100
pushed 2018-01-11 21:05 +0000
Nicholas Nethercote Nicholas Nethercote - Bug 1416638 - Add a PrefValueKind arg to Preferences::Get*(), and remove Preferences::GetDefault*(). r=glandium
8409d8b905182bd075f9a93ae022baf118fe8072
created 2017-12-08 17:21 -0500
pushed 2017-12-08 22:22 +0000
Ryan VanderMeulen Ryan VanderMeulen - Backed out changeset b3559b717873 (bug 1421313) for Android crashes.
b3559b717873d1b0bd240f68b98bc960c860fb7b
created 2017-12-04 08:56 -0600
pushed 2017-12-08 20:18 +0000
James Willcox James Willcox - Bug 1421313 - Remove TexturePoolOGL. r=jgilbert, a=jcristau
14c25243ff09f821780950f3a87ce82ccc77174f
created 2017-11-10 07:30 -0500
pushed 2017-11-10 21:18 +0000
JerryShih JerryShih - Bug 1415816 - integrate gfxCriticalNote/gfxCriticalError for WebRender in gpu process. r=kats
9e776a8529b63e20c1ea4ea98227c1a725a8ea62
created 2017-11-01 21:44 -0700
pushed 2017-11-02 16:33 +0000
Phil Ringnalda Phil Ringnalda - Backed out 4 changesets (bug 1406327) for crashing other tests, crashing itself, and assertion failures
345972733daa16372a6c26ffd6fb781966a87fa7
created 2017-10-26 16:51 +0800
pushed 2017-11-02 16:33 +0000
Daosheng Mu Daosheng Mu - Bug 1406327 - Part 1: Shutdown VR listener thread when no VR content in seconds; r=dvander,kip
f6bc432fe59656a3e23f85e73e00f90f64ce8a6d
created 2017-11-01 11:15 +0200
pushed 2017-11-02 16:33 +0000
Attila Craciun Attila Craciun - Backed out changeset 996d843e1eb8 (bug 1406327) for failing dom/vr/test/mochitest/test_vrController_displayId.html r=backout on a CLOSED TREE.
996d843e1eb8025c069c812292831f34b5f8b1d3
created 2017-10-26 16:51 +0800
pushed 2017-11-02 16:33 +0000
Daosheng Mu Daosheng Mu - Bug 1406327 - Part 1: Shutdown VR listener thread when no VR content in seconds; r=dvander,kip
90294812319d0ab7229ff021c5022c05e151999b
created 2017-10-31 22:33 -0700
pushed 2017-11-02 16:33 +0000
Phil Ringnalda Phil Ringnalda - Backed out 3 changesets (bug 1406327) for bustage in tests that run after the VM tests
e1e57d418c14e6d4d96ecabc7d41a08f0b981a57
created 2017-10-26 16:51 +0800
pushed 2017-11-02 16:33 +0000
Daosheng Mu Daosheng Mu - Bug 1406327 - Part 1: Shutdown VR listener thread when no VR content in seconds; r=dvander,kip
2b9e21d1b0cfe2849a8fec31136cc6e52f3f520c
created 2017-10-31 13:52 +0800
pushed 2017-11-02 16:33 +0000
JerryShih JerryShih - Bug 1413043 - check WR enabling status before the WR calls. r=pchang
1c618b1a13662de7cec429f606367db3827b6dc7
created 2017-10-30 14:51 +0200
pushed 2017-11-02 16:33 +0000
Coroiu Cristina Coroiu Cristina - Backed out changeset b7a07167905c::2932c914e223 (bug 1406327) for failing in dom/vr/test/mochitest/test_vrController_displayId.html r=backout a=backout on a CLOSED TREE
515407ebfa1433c31144374313bbfd8b942af41c
created 2017-10-30 12:16 +0200
pushed 2017-11-02 16:33 +0000
Coroiu Cristina Coroiu Cristina - Merge inbound to mozilla-central r=merge a=merge
ee22692d98442c179f72db76b3a6bfa0f37dcaaf
created 2017-10-30 11:31 +0800
pushed 2017-11-02 16:33 +0000
JerryShih JerryShih - Bug 1399389 - redirect the warn/error message to gfx_critical_error/note in WR. r=kvark
b7a07167905c19812ed9253746b2f27afa0742b2
created 2017-10-26 16:51 +0800
pushed 2017-11-02 16:33 +0000
Daosheng Mu Daosheng Mu - Bug 1406327 - Part 1: Shutdown VR listener thread when no VR content in seconds; r=dvander,kip
2db53725248967c97567665705ff0eca53b9ea6d
created 2017-10-05 18:12 +0800
pushed 2017-11-02 16:33 +0000
Daosheng Mu Daosheng Mu - Bug 1392216 - Part 1: Create VR listener thread in GPU process; r=dvander,kip
67a8e12324569dd730347187e2ffccae486c758b
created 2017-10-03 09:05 +1100
pushed 2017-11-02 16:33 +0000
Nicholas Nethercote Nicholas Nethercote - Bug 1400460 - Rename nsIAtom as nsAtom. r=hiro.
0291da9106db784d6bc2e92415590ad30c70d1dd
created 2017-10-02 16:30 -0700
pushed 2017-11-02 16:33 +0000
David Anderson David Anderson - Change OMTP feature reporting in about:support. (bug 1404532, r=rhunt)
b00cd35474a0ffa96b76ed255eb35a3763b51be2
created 2017-10-02 02:19 +0200
pushed 2017-11-02 16:33 +0000
Bas Schouten Bas Schouten - Bug 1404587: Disable OMTP when using cairo as the content backend. r=mattwoodrow
f4c8f95554888546a066e98a8e017eb579ca51df
created 2017-09-27 11:49 +0200
pushed 2017-11-02 16:33 +0000
Sebastian Hengst Sebastian Hengst - merge mozilla-central to autoland. r=merge a=merge
4609ab443fb8c1ec70fb403567c342609194f5a2
created 2017-09-26 17:32 +0200
pushed 2017-11-02 16:33 +0000
Jean-Yves Avenard Jean-Yves Avenard - Bug 1403190 - P3. Rename and re-organise dxva prefs. r=cpearce
52715572c20a3462c8bbc6a871a7dfb60446ac8e
created 2017-09-26 17:00 +0200
pushed 2017-11-02 16:33 +0000
Jean-Yves Avenard Jean-Yves Avenard - Bug 1403190 - P1. Rename media.windows-media-foundation.* into media.wmf.* prefs. r=cpearce
4dc05aa0edae93b24c55f8e357ef8cb15bbe9f51
created 2017-09-27 10:18 +0200
pushed 2017-11-02 16:33 +0000
Sebastian Hengst Sebastian Hengst - Backed out changeset 31a7d05125cc (bug 1403190) for breaking Windows builds due to wrong closing quotation marks in preferences file. r=backout on a CLOSED TREE
6afa923a83c429a9dfef91bc14be518e031a6522
created 2017-09-27 10:16 +0200
pushed 2017-11-02 16:33 +0000
Sebastian Hengst Sebastian Hengst - Backed out changeset e6eb65564b76 (bug 1403190)
e6eb65564b76235018b7f79297d9562f6ce38c3a
created 2017-09-26 17:32 +0200
pushed 2017-11-02 16:33 +0000
Jean-Yves Avenard Jean-Yves Avenard - Bug 1403190 - P3. Rename and re-organise dxva prefs. r=cpearce
31a7d05125ccb219dcbdfc7e2e34578e9c31bcf0
created 2017-09-26 17:00 +0200
pushed 2017-11-02 16:33 +0000
Jean-Yves Avenard Jean-Yves Avenard - Bug 1403190 - P1. Rename media.windows-media-foundation.* into media.wmf.* prefs. r=cpearce
feb35ae6b09fe3e74a01b15e0fe68b598304893a
created 2017-09-26 23:58 -0400
pushed 2017-11-02 16:33 +0000
Jeff Muizelaar Jeff Muizelaar - Bug 1403214 - Fix webrender debug prefs. r=nical
5b793946076c553a26a4db76aa7bd2dd08f1286a
created 2017-09-25 10:47 -0400
pushed 2017-11-02 16:33 +0000
Kartikaya Gupta Kartikaya Gupta - Bug 1402704 - Ensure WebRender cannot be enabled on Android. r=jrmuizel
4832416f0a867e028792fe0654b32f95fa94f10a
created 2017-09-14 17:26 +0100
pushed 2017-09-16 16:13 +0000
Jonathan Kew Jonathan Kew - Bug 1334761 - Update ClearType usage at startup, and flush caches and reflow everything if it changes during the session. r=bas
04b1b915604a918556f7b6d9ce36ca591752715c
created 2017-08-29 16:27 -0400
pushed 2017-09-15 00:19 +0000
Botond Ballo Botond Ballo - Bug 1394926 - Add APZ autoscroll information to about:support. r=kats
e5e5c2fe0f99efd5209df000883e911087947fd4
created 2017-08-09 18:00 +0800
pushed 2017-09-15 00:19 +0000
Kevin Chen Kevin Chen - Bug 1362321 - Do not crash in gfxPlatform:Init if there is a TDR happening; r=bas
ba0451006e9fe8c93f5d408933f7af684f89932e
created 2017-08-23 12:00 +0200
pushed 2017-09-15 00:19 +0000
Nicolas Silva Nicolas Silva - Bug 1390840 - Add prefs to display the debugging view of webrender's texture cache and intermediate targets. r=jrmuizel
226958859036e7562eead0fa8e321d238f38e9c8
created 2017-08-21 18:38 +0200
pushed 2017-09-15 00:19 +0000
Sebastian Hengst Sebastian Hengst - Backed out changeset b9c53ad8893b (bug 1390840)
b9c53ad8893b177521d194a10140eae14da49297
created 2017-08-21 18:22 +0200
pushed 2017-09-15 00:19 +0000
Nicolas Silva Nicolas Silva - Bug 1390840 - Add prefs to display the debugging view of webrender's texture cache and intermediate targets. r=jrmuizel
fdbcfc9b798737b01e06b953441c4a2ffb5c168a
created 2017-08-17 21:06 -0700
pushed 2017-09-15 00:19 +0000
Phil Ringnalda Phil Ringnalda - Backed out 7 changesets (bug 1390386) for Android crashes in testSettingsPages
1314405cf812ecb8757a1e0d9ce632d042c3916d
created 2017-08-11 13:41 -0700
pushed 2017-09-15 00:19 +0000
Jeff Gilbert Jeff Gilbert - Bug 1390386 - Remove old TLS current-context check. - r=daoshengmu
2241628188e42f3d716132e2388aa60f054bdf31
created 2017-08-15 15:32 -0700
pushed 2017-09-15 00:19 +0000
Mason Chang Mason Chang - Bug 1390002 There are some paths to find out if dwrite is enabled, which inits gfxPlatform, which requires information from PopulateScreenInfo, which depends on the refresh driver existing. At this time however, we haven't initialized our vsync source so we crash. This moves vsync initialization earlier in the gfx pipeline. r=kats
20a3ffcebfd188d3408638d09cd16c0fad6b4cec
created 2017-08-08 16:01 -0700
pushed 2017-09-15 00:19 +0000
Michael Smith Michael Smith - Bug 1387764 - Disable WebRender if HW_COMPOSITING is disabled. r=kats
b1f2be9ad554279190fd751e8252330b912ecffb
created 2017-08-07 16:20 -0400
pushed 2017-09-15 00:19 +0000
Lee Salzman Lee Salzman - Bug 1385029 - require implementation of gfxFont::GetScaledFont and remove unnecessary gfxPlatform::GetScaledFontForFont. r=jfkthame
db5a86cfd703c9bd245fd3bb26f2163c4b91b6ab
created 2017-07-06 17:45 -0700
pushed 2017-09-15 00:19 +0000
Michael Smith Michael Smith - Bug 1373739 - Make headless compositing Windows-compatible, in addition to Linux. r=dvander
2baaba7b398c96350ff6ce32fb3235a78be4da9b
created 2017-08-28 00:28 -0400
pushed 2017-08-30 14:59 +0000
Kevin Chen Kevin Chen - Bug 1362321 - Do not crash in gfxPlatform:Init if there is a TDR happening. r=bas, a=gchang
09be13b2551d805bef7cb88f1e1c082dd67e3c78
created 2017-08-15 15:32 -0700
pushed 2017-08-18 11:43 +0000
Mason Chang Mason Chang - Bug 1390002 - There are some paths to find out if dwrite is enabled, which inits gfxPlatform, which requires information from PopulateScreenInfo, which depends on the refresh driver existing. At this time however, we haven't initialized our vsync source so we crash. This moves vsync initialization earlier in the gfx pipeline. r=kats, a=gchang
2b347fb55a9965acec727f6e40671ba859636603
created 2017-07-31 14:28 +1000
pushed 2017-08-02 08:25 +0000
Nicholas Nethercote Nicholas Nethercote - Bug 1384835 (part 3, attempt 2) - Remove the Preferences::Get*CString() variants that return nsAdoptingCString. r=froydnj.
less more (0) -1000 -300 -100 -60 tip